Cowdenbeath Train Station ensures a smooth ticket purchasing process with both a ticket office and machines. The ticket office operates from Monday to Saturday but is closed on Sundays. For travelers who purchase tickets online, collection is stress-free, thanks to the accessible ticket machines. Despite the station's modest size, you'll find essential conveniences such as seating areas and a basic waiting room housed within the ticket office.
For those with accessibility needs, note that Cowdenbeath is a Category B2 station. Expect parts of the station to be step-free, though steep ramps and stairs connect the platforms. Assistance is available during ticket office hours, and an array of support services such as induction loops further enhance accessibility. While there are no dedicated accessible car parking spaces or wheelchairs provided, help points throughout the station are in place to assist travelers.
A range of onward travel options are available, from local bus services to taxis, catering to your needs whether you're continuing your journey close to home or reaching farther destinations. Taxis can be hailed via services listed on traintaxi.co.uk, while detailed bus service information is accessible on the Traveline Scotland website.
If you’re confronted with a rail replacement situation, pick-up and drop-off points for buses are conveniently located on High Street at the foot of the ramp from Platform 2. To locate this, use the ///what3words app for precise directions.

The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from 07:00 to 18:00 on weekdays, and from 09:00 to 18:00 on Saturdays, ensuring easy access to tickets and customer support. Additionally, you can collect tickets purchased online at the on-site ticket machines available for your convenience. However, it's important to note that the station does not provide accessible ticket machines, so those with mobility challenges should plan accordingly.
Stourbridge Town Station features step-free access throughout, making it classified as a category A station in terms of accessibility. While it lacks certain amenities such as waiting rooms and restrooms, it compensates with essential services like CCTV for safety, induction loops for the hearing-impaired, and assistance from friendly station staff or help points during operational hours. Bicycle enthusiasts will find limited storage with CCTV oversight for extra security.
For those planning onward journeys, the station provides solid transport links. Rail replacement services operate from Vauxhall Road nearby, and if you require local transportation, a variety of reliable taxi services are available just a stone's throw away from the station.
